Proteus Mirabilis is a gram-negative, (thin peptidoglycan layer with outer membrane), motile, bacillus belonging to the Enterobacteriaceae family of bacteria. It is widely found in soil and water and can also be found in the normal human intestinal flora. imtoo iphone contacts transfer https://foxhillbaby.com

WebBacteria of the genus Proteus commonly are encountered in nature and frequently are associated with humans where they act as opportunistic pathogens and cause a variety of infections. They belong to the tribe Proteeae (other genera include Morganella and Providencia) in the family Enterobacteriaceae. WebP. mirabilis is the main cause of all Proteus spp. infections accounting for 80–90 % of them. It is postulated that human intestines are a reservoir of Proteus bacteria, especially those belonging to prevailing P. mirabilis species, and they are members of natural fecal microflora of several percent of human population [ 124 ].

Genes encoding enzymes that are involved in the biosynthesis of core oligosaccharides are shown along with lines that … lithonia crimeWebProteus mirabilis is a common cause of upper and lower UTIs in dogs as well as otitis externa and uncommonly pyoderma. It produces a potent urease and so may contribute to development of struvite urolithiasis.
